1.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Choose the correct answer: </p>, :p, p:, <p>
Back
<p>
Answer explanation
The correct answer is <p> because it represents the opening tag of a paragraph in HTML. The other options are either incorrectly formatted or do not represent valid HTML tags.

5.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What belongs at the beginning and end of every tag?
Back
< >
Answer explanation
The correct answer is < > because these symbols are used to denote the beginning and end of HTML tags. Other options do not represent tag syntax in HTML.
